Ukrainian President Petro Poroshenko has said that the country has managed to overcome economic hardships, restore growth and start increasing income of Ukrainians. We proceed from belt tightening to gradual increase of Ukrainians income. There are grounds to believe that we are over the worst in the social and economic spheres, the head of state said in Mariupol on Dec. 31. He said that the Ukrainian economy has overcome a shock from hostilities and the closure of the Russian market for Ukrainians goods, as well as the routes for their export to the third countries. This was a true commercial and transit blockade, which seriously affected the Ukrainians standard of living, he said. We have withstood and adapted to the new conditions, we managed to restore growth. However, we must express gratitude to the people of Ukraine, first of all for their understanding of unbiased difficulties, for their patience in times of social turmoil, Mr Poroshenko said. The president said that international partners of Ukraine understand that in two and a half years Ukraine had done more reforms than over the past two decades.
